Is flowback a hard job?

Flowback in the oilfield involves managing the process of returning fluids from a well after hydraulic fracturing, which can be physically demanding and requires working in outdoor, often remote environments. The job typically involves long shifts, heavy equipment, and safety precautions, making it physically and mentally challenging for many workers.

Key Accountabilities:

  • Learning the skills to be responsible for a specific 12-hour shift operating equipment on site.
  • Responsible for safe and proper use of hand tools.
  • Responsible for assisting in loading and unloading equipment being shipped and arriving on site for the job or job type to be undertaken.
  • Rig up and rig down of site equipment as instructed.
  • Learn to gather and record data and operate equipment by Operator III, Operator II, and Operator, including but not limited to exploration, production, in-line well testing, stimulation recovery, and flowback for our customer.
  • Learn proper maintenance, repair, and service of equipment, including compressors, generators, pumps, etc., as instructed by Operator III and the Field Supervisor.
  • Learn to repair and service equipment in the shop and the field.
  • Site-specific duties include essential motor maintenance on generator sets and compressors as well as any other duties specified by Operator II and Operator III. Duties and responsibilities will increase as you progress.
  • Ongoing communications, including half-hourly data reporting to Operator III and Field Supervisor.
  • Service and care of field service vehicles, tools, and command center on location.
  • Operators must continuously gain knowledge in all aspects of their jobs from ongoing training supplied by Trilogy staff on location.
